Beijing’s Hottest Lunar New Year Traditions to Try in 2026 ❄️🏮

As Beijing transforms into a red-and-gold wonderland for Lunar New Year 2026, young adventurers are discovering timeless traditions that blend ancient customs with modern fun. From icy thrills to sugary treats, here's how to celebrate like a true Beijinger this Spring Festival!

❄️ Glide Through History at Outdoor Ice Rinks

Locals are flocking to frozen lakes in Houhai and Shichahai, where ice skating becomes a multigenerational party. Pro tip: Rent traditional ice chairs (you haven't lived until you've pushed your friends across the ice!) ⛸️

🎪 Temple Fair Treasure Hunts

This year's Ditan Park and Longtan Park fairs are serving serious #RetroVibes with:
– Sugar painting stations (create edible art!) 🍯
– Pitch pot challenges (ancient basketball meets poetry)
– Copper coin games testing precision and luck
